43-Entidades HTML

HTML






Entidades HTML

Las entidades HTML son secuencias de caracteres especiales que representan símbolos o caracteres que no se pueden incluir directamente en el código. Son útiles para representar símbolos como <, >, o incluso caracteres que no están disponibles en el teclado.

Ejemplos comunes:

  • &amp; para &
  • &lt; para <
  • &gt; para >
  • &quot; para "
  • &apos; para '

Ejemplo


  &lt;div&gt;Este es un texto dentro de un div&lt;/div&gt;
  &lt;h1&gt;Título con tilde&lt;/h1&gt;
          



...
Espacio sin romper

El espacio sin romper o &nbsp; es un carácter especial que impide que dos palabras o elementos separados por este espacio se dividan entre líneas. Se utiliza cuando no deseas que el contenido se "rompa" al final de una línea.


Ejemplo


  <p>Esto es un espacio sin romper.</p>
          



Algunas entidades de carácter HTML útiles

Result Description Name Number
  non-breaking space &nbsp;  
< less than &lt; <
> greater than &gt; >
& ampersand &amp; &
" double quotation mark &quot; "
' single quotation mark &apos; '
¢ cent &cent; ¢
£ pound &pound; £
¥ yen &yen; ¥
euro &euro;
© copyright &copy; ©
® trademark &reg; ®



Combinando marcas diacríticas

En HTML, puedes combinar marcas diacríticas, como tildes o acentos, con letras usando Unicode o entidades HTML. Esto te permite representar caracteres que no están directamente en tu teclado.

Por ejemplo:

  • &aacute; para á
  • &eacute; para é
  • &iacute; para í

Mark Character Construct Result
̀ a
́ a
̂ a
̃ a
̀ O
́ O
̂ O
̃ O

Ejemplo


  <p>La palabra "cancion" con tilde: canci&oacute;n.</p>
          






Publicar un comentario

0 Comentarios